INGREDIENTS:
![chocolate.jpg](/proxy/?url=https://content.instructables.com/F79/6AJ6/IUYD2G17/F796AJ6IUYD2G17.jpg&filename=chocolate.jpg)
- 1 1/2 cup whole milk
- 1/2 cup heavy cream
- 2 teaspoons powdered s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on espresso powder or instant coffee( This is optional,but it’ll enhance the chocolate flavor!)
- 7 oz dark chocolate ( 70%,chopped) or chocolate chips
- 1/4 cup creamy peanut butter(or any other nut butter)
DIRECTIONS:
![hot choco.jpg](/proxy/?url=https://content.instructables.com/FP2/MDQB/IUYD2G1U/FP2MDQBIUYD2G1U.jpg&filename=hot choco.jpg)
![zoom hot chocolate.jpg](/proxy/?url=https://content.instructables.com/FY2/XDMA/IUYD2G0N/FY2XDMAIUYD2G0N.jpg&filename=zoom hot chocolate.jpg)
- In a medium saucepan oven medium heat, whisk together whole milk,heavy cream,powdered sugar and coffee,until small babbles appear around edges.
- Do not allow mixture to boil.Remove saucepan from heat,add peanut butter and chopped chocolate until melted,returning the sauce to low heat if needed for the chocolate to melt completely.
- Serve warm, topped with lots of whipped cream and drizzled some caramel sauce on top!
